Technical Field
[0001] This utility model relates to the field of drainage well construction technology, and in particular to the sealing structure of drainage wells. Background Technology
[0002] In construction projects, especially during the construction of underground garage foundation pits, it is very important to manage groundwater reasonably and effectively. The traditional approach is to lower the groundwater level by setting up dewatering wells and dewatering wells after the foundation pit is excavated, so as to ensure the safety and efficiency of dry trench operations.
[0003] Provided that dry trenching operations are permitted, the dewatering wells and dewatering wells in the middle of the underground garage foundation pit can be gradually sealed during raft slab construction. The dewatering wells at the edge of the foundation pit can be dewatered only after the foundation pit backfilling, garage roof backfilling, and the main structure progress meets the anti-buoyancy requirements. If the groundwater level can meet the requirements for dry trenching operations and anti-buoyancy after dewatering the dewatering wells within the foundation area is stopped before foundation construction, the wells can be sealed using the ordinary well sealing method. If the ordinary well sealing method is used for all wells, the groundwater level will not meet the requirements for dry trenching operations and anti-buoyancy after dewatering the dewatering wells within the foundation area is stopped before foundation construction. Utility Model Content
[0004] In view of the above-mentioned problems existing in the prior art, the main purpose of this utility model is to provide a closed structure for drainage wells.
[0005] The technical solution of this utility model is as follows: a closed structure for a drainage well includes a well pipe, the inside of which is backfilled with medium-coarse sand or graded gravel, a plain concrete cushion layer is poured on top of the well pipe, a steel plate ring is pre-embedded inside the plain concrete cushion layer and above the well pipe, a structural raft slab is poured on top of the plain concrete cushion layer, a steel pipe is welded to the inner wall of the well pipe, a circular steel plate is fully welded at the opening of the medium-coarse sand or graded gravel, the circular steel plate is used to seal the well pipe, a water-stop steel plate ring is welded to the top of the steel pipe, and the water-stop steel plate ring is set inside the structural raft slab.
[0006] By adopting the above technical solution, a reliable method of post-sealing wells is provided in case the groundwater level cannot meet the requirements for dry trench operation and anti-buoyancy after the dewatering of the drainage wells within the foundation area is stopped before foundation construction. This ensures that groundwater will not flow into the foundation pit again, thereby guaranteeing construction quality and safety.
[0007] In a preferred embodiment, an annular support plate is welded to the bottom of the steel pipe, the annular support plate is installed on the upper surface of the plain concrete cushion layer, and the annular support plate is embedded inside the structural raft slab.
[0008] By adopting the above technical solution and using the ring support plate, the steel pipe and the water-stop steel plate ring can play an important supporting role.
[0009] In a preferred embodiment, a waterproof additional layer is provided around the perimeter of the well pipe, and the width of the waterproof additional layer is not less than 500 mm.
[0010] By adopting the above technical solution and using the additional waterproof layer, groundwater can be prevented from rising to the bottom of the water-stop steel plate ring. At the same time, the waterproofing should be done well with the sealing structure to prevent groundwater from seeping through the gap between the well pipe and the structural raft slab.
[0011] In a preferred embodiment, the structural raft slab has an internal mounting groove for use with a circular steel plate, and the circular steel plate is installed inside the mounting groove.
[0012] By adopting the above technical solution and setting up the installation groove, an installation site can be provided for the circular steel plate, thereby reducing the exposure of the circular steel plate.
[0013] In a preferred embodiment, both ends of the water-stop steel plate ring are secured with anchor rods, and the bottom ends of the anchor rods are inserted into the plain concrete pad layer.
[0014] By adopting the above technical solution and using anchor bolts, the connection strength between the water-stop steel plate ring, steel pipe, annular support plate and plain concrete pad can be strengthened.
[0015] In a preferred embodiment, the steel pipe has a diameter of 325 mm and a wall thickness of 10 mm.
[0016] By adopting the above technical solution and using steel pipes, the installation height of the water-stop steel plate ring can be increased.
[0017] In a preferred embodiment, the interior of the water-stop steel plate ring is provided with mounting holes for use with anchor rods, and the size of the mounting holes matches that of the anchor rods.
[0018] By adopting the above technical solution, it is easier for workers to connect the anchor rod to the water-stop steel plate ring.
[0019] Compared with the prior art, the advantages and positive effects of this utility model are as follows:
[0020] In this invention, the use of steel plate ring one can achieve the purpose of sealing the groundwater level for the first time. The water-stopping steel plate ring and circular steel plate on the steel pipe can achieve the purpose of sealing the groundwater level multiple times. The backfilling with medium and coarse sand or graded sand and gravel can improve the sealing performance between the water-stopping steel plate ring and steel plate ring one, and enhance the overall stability. If the groundwater level cannot meet the requirements of dry trench operation and anti-buoyancy after the dewatering wells within the foundation area are stopped before foundation construction, a reliable post-sealing well method is provided to ensure that groundwater will not flow into the foundation pit again, thereby ensuring construction quality and safety. [0029] Working principle: If the groundwater level cannot meet the requirements for dry trench operation and anti-buoyancy after pumping out the dewatering wells within the foundation area before foundation construction, the well can be sealed using the post-sealing method. The specific method is as follows: First, before constructing the raft foundation 4, prepare the steel pipe 7 and weld a ring support plate 6 to the outside of the steel pipe 7, with the ring support plate 6 facing the plain concrete foundation 3. Install the steel pipe 7 during foundation foundation construction, and clean the surface of the steel pipe 7 before waterproofing. Make a waterproof additional layer of not less than 500 mm wide around the casing, and use the waterproof additional layer to... This method prevents groundwater from overflowing to the bottom of the water-stop steel ring 8. At the same time, waterproofing requires proper sealing of the edges to prevent groundwater from seeping through the gap between the well pipe 1 and the structural raft 4. After the structural raft 4 is poured and meets the structural anti-buoyancy requirements, the drainage well is sealed. Then, medium-coarse sand or graded gravel 2 is backfilled and measures are taken to compact the filler to 2m below the structural raft 4. Then, a water-stop steel ring 8 is welded inside the steel pipe 7 and concrete is poured to the opening of the well pipe 1. Then, a circular steel plate 9 is fully welded to the opening of the well pipe 1 to seal it. Finally, concrete is poured to the top elevation of the raft slab.
